I had a scheduled Unifi installation on 8th Aug for 11am.

At 8am on the same day, I got a SMS (not call) informing that the installation is postponed, requesting me to call to their call center to follow up.
When I did, they mentioned to me that there is a 'major equipment' breakdown and it's affecting the Unifi installation at landed house in entire country.
And they estimated that they could only start installation on 24th Aug, which I find it absurd.

Issue is due to Alcatel Lucents ONU, affects FTTH installation mostly.

We agents also was notified last minute.

QUOTE
Due to current issue with ONU by Alcatel Lucent, all addresses served by Alcatel Lucent's OLT have been removed from UnifiSearch from 15th August 2015.The issue is expected to be solved by 24th August 2015

OFFICIAL

TM is in the midst of resolving the issue. At the moment, we have temporarily deferred all new service installation and relocation activities from 8 August until 15 August. We expect to resume the activities in phases starting 24 August onwards. Our appointment centre will be in touch with you in phases starting 17 August onwards to reschedule your new appointment date.

Announcement from TM:

TM will contact all effected customers to reschedule the new appointment date started on 2nd September and the new appointment will be on 24th September 2014 onward. It will be done in phases until all backlog completed.
The issue expected to be resolved by end September 2015. TM will open for application of New Installation and Service Relocation starting on 1st October 2015.
